Adult Education Hourly Teacher
Brief Description of Position
• Develop and presents lessons to students; evaluates student progress; maintains proper classroom control and learning environment; assist in curriculum development.
Major Duties and Responsibilities
• Develops and presents lessons that demonstrate and preparation which are consistent with the approved course of study.
• Develops and presents lessons where performance objectives/competencies are understood by the student and are supportive of district goals.
• Evaluates student progress based primarily on achievement of performance objectives/competencies.
• Uses a variety of instructional techniques and materials which are appropriate to the course and to adult students.
• Maintains current and accurate records of student attendance and progress.
• Demonstrate and promotes punctuality.
• Participates with fellow staff members in the development and implementation of curriculum and instruction.
• Keeps up to date in subject area and continually works for the improvement of instructional techniques.
• Adheres to approved course of study policies and procedures.
• Attends and participates in program and district meetings.
• Supervises the proper use of equipment and facilitates with the student's safety in mind.
